“FEC Tees Up Coordination Rule for Meeting; Delay in Releasing Draft May Signal Problems”

BNA offers this report ($), which begins: “The Federal Election Commission has indicated in a new agenda document that it will consider at an Aug. 26 open meeting long-promised new rules regarding ‘coordinated communications’ and ‘federal election activity.’ The FEC, however, had not released the draft final regulations by the afternoon of Aug. 24, suggesting that the six FEC commissioners may not yet be in agreement on the rules.”
